The gombessa article has > said {komoros} since I first wrote it; but in French they are called > Comores, with the last two letters silent, and the language there (a > close relative of Swahili) is called Shikomor, in which the islands > are called Komori. So should the word be {koMOR}? That sounds to me like a reasonable compromise. Is there a default strategy in Lojban for which language to borrow names from? English? The language of education in the area? The 'native' language in the area, if that's meaningful? What about places or people which are called X in the local language but are more widely-known internationally as Y, the name that another language gives to the place or person? What about areas that are bilingual? For example, is it {la brikSEL} or {la brisel}? What about Sorbian towns in eastern Germany - {la kotbus} or {la xocebus} (taking a guess at the Sorbian pronunciation)?. Cheers, Philip -- Philip Newton
